> Recent WMI/HTC changes made it possible for WMI
> commands to sleep (if there's not enough HTC TX
> credits to submit a command). TX path is in an
> atomic context so calling WMI commands in it is
> wrong.
>
> This simply moves WEP key index update to a worker
> and fixes the 'scheduling while atomic' bug.
>
> This still leaves multiple WEP key handling laggy,
> i.e. some frames may be TXed with an old/different
> key (although recipient should still be able to RX
> them).
